Preparation for your interview at Magic Leap should focus on understanding both the technical and interpersonal aspects of the Product Manager role.
Role-related knowledge – This criterion assesses your familiarity with product management principles, augmented reality technology, and market trends. Interviewers look for candidates who can demonstrate industry knowledge and apply it effectively in product strategy.
Problem-solving ability – How you approach challenges and structure your responses is critical. Strong candidates can articulate their thought processes clearly and provide structured methodologies for tackling issues.
Leadership – Your ability to communicate, influence, and collaborate with diverse teams is essential. Demonstrate your leadership style and provide examples of successful team dynamics you have fostered.
Culture fit / values – Magic Leap places a strong emphasis on innovation, creativity, and collaboration. Candidates must showcase how their values align with the company’s mission and how they contribute to a positive team culture.
Interview Process Overview
The interview process for a Product Manager at Magic Leap typically flows through several stages designed to evaluate both your technical skills and cultural fit. You can expect an initial phone screen, followed by several rounds of interviews that may include technical assessments, behavioral interviews, and case studies. Throughout the process, Magic Leap emphasizes clarity and communication, ensuring candidates are informed at each stage.
Candidates often report a thoughtful experience, with the interviewers genuinely interested in candidate backgrounds and perspectives. The process is rigorous, reflecting the complexity of the role, but maintains a collaborative tone.

Deep Dive into Evaluation Areas
Understanding how you will be evaluated is key to your success. Below are major evaluation areas specific to the Product Manager role at Magic Leap.
Role-related Knowledge
This area is fundamental as it encompasses your understanding of product management principles and the augmented reality industry. Interviewers assess your familiarity with market trends, user needs, and product strategy. Strong performance involves demonstrating a comprehensive grasp of both your specific product area and broader industry context.
- User Experience (UX) – Understanding user-centered design principles and how to apply them to product development.
- Market Analysis – Ability to analyze market trends and competitors to inform product decisions.
- Technical Acumen – Familiarity with the technology stack relevant to augmented reality products.
Problem-Solving Ability
Your problem-solving skills will be assessed through case studies and situational questions. Interviewers look for structured thinking, creativity, and analytical skills. Strong candidates can articulate their problem-solving methods and provide examples of past challenges.
- Critical Thinking – Ability to break down complex problems into manageable parts.
- Data-Driven Decisions – Use of data to inform product decisions and evaluate success.
- Adaptability – Capability to pivot when faced with new information or changing market conditions.
Leadership
Leadership evaluation focuses on your ability to influence and motivate teams. Interviewers assess your communication style and how well you work with others. Strong candidates show a history of successful collaboration and team engagement.
- Influence – Examples of how you’ve led teams or projects without direct authority.
- Mentorship – Instances where you’ve guided or developed team members.
- Conflict Resolution – Strategies for managing and resolving conflicts effectively.
Culture Fit / Values
Magic Leap values innovation, collaboration, and a commitment to excellence. Candidates should demonstrate alignment with these values through their experiences and outlook.
- Team Collaboration – Examples of how you have contributed to team success.
- Innovative Thinking – Situations where you’ve introduced new ideas or improved processes.
- User Focus – Demonstrating a commitment to understanding and addressing user needs.
